About Wave Court
Wave Court is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Romford (RM7 0FA). It has a recorded floor area of 63 m² (around 678 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2012 onwards and council tax band D. The latest certificate (March 2022) returns a B (score 83), comfortably above the UK average. The rating has held steady at B across 2 certificates since March 2012.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good. At 63 m² this is the 39th smallest of 64 units on EPC record in Wave Court, where floor areas span 40–79 m². The building's EPC ratings span C to B, with this unit at the top. Other recorded features include a balcony.
At 63 m² it's 16.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(54 m² median across 63 EPCs). Across 2012–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 6%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£465/sq ft) was about 56.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£315,000 in October 2022.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
